Full Description
The mill was built for silk throwing, which requires a low power capacity. The mill is situated away from known water sources, suggesting the use of horse power. Steam powered by 1870's. Now demolished (1). The reference 1 locates the mill at SJ8541 6311. This location is near the river and contradicts the text. Also no mills are shown on the OS maps at this location. Suggested location is at SJ8570 6298, in a mill building marked on the OS 1st ed. 25" map, at Swan Bank (2).
